WebNov 9, 2024 · A chargeback is an action taken by a bank to reverse electronic payments. It involves reversing a payment and triggering a dispute resolution process. Generally, chargebacks occur between a ... WebOct 4, 2024 · Fines exceeding $10,000 can also be levied against businesses where monthly chargeback rates go over a certain number. Too many fines and the retailer may be labeled as “high risk” by credit card companies and even lose credit card processing privileges or be hit with higher chargeback fees and penalties.
